El Grupo Nuevo De Omar Rodriguez Lopez: “Half Kleptos”

by Aubin Paul Rodriguez Lopez Productions Music 17 years ago

El Nuevo Grupo De Omar Rodriguez Lopez, the side project from Omar Rodriguez Lopez have released a new song from their forthcoming debut. The record is titled Cryptomnesia II and is due out May 5, 2009. Along with the Mars Volta guitarist, the band features frequent collaborator (and Mars Volta bandmate) Cedric Bixler Zavala, Zach Hill of Hella, Jonathan Hischke and Juan Alderete de la Pena.
